  20. islay

    islay Savant (1,211) Jan 6, 2008 Minnesota

    The other site lists 103 active as of this writing, of which approximately 16 (my count was quick) are client brewers. It does have a few sloppy entries, such as O'Gara's, which, as far as I know, hasn't brewed beer in years but still operates as a bar, and Lion's Tap, which renames Cold Spring beers and puts them on tap, as brewpubs, but these are known issues to admins. I believe that Skyview, one of the admins over there, has a clean-up project for this sort of thing on his long-term agenda.

    Add in the known BIPs, and, if anything, 135 is conservative. I'm tracking over 30 BIPs in the Twin Cities area of the state alone (some of which, admittedly, surely will never open).
